On Thursday, June 2, Extreme Community Makeover organized an Industry Work Day geared towards people working in the real estate industry. Heritage Title Company, PorchLight Real Estate, and ValueCheck, Inc. were the organizations that signed up for the day.20160602_110825-X2"Too many of us get to wrapped up in our technology. Volunteering in our communities makes us more mindful of our surroundings and helps us to get back to the basics," explains Coey Howe a Sales Executive with Heritage Title Company. She's been volunteering with ECM for about four years now. Coey thankful that Heritage Title Company has a volunteer group. Research shows that volunteering with co-workers improves morale and helps employees to make deeper connections. "ECM always does a great job of organizing everything. In our very busy lives and work schedules, it's nice to know we can accomplish so much and all we have to do it show up," admits Coey.Connie Malonson, the Regional Vice-President of Heritage Title Company, thought the day volunteering went great as well. Her sales team made valuable connections with real estate agents and they enjoyed the conversations that took place while they worked. "The Industry Work Day is a good networking opportunity for people in our industry. The Work Day helps us to connect with each other professionally, but it also is beneficial because we all have a common goal to do good in our communities. It's good to do business with others you know have common goals and values," says Connie.20160602_094307-X2Caroline Glidden, a Broker Associate at PorchLight Real Estate, was on Extreme Community Makeover's Board a 20160602_114129-XLcouple years ago. So, she is very familiar with ECM. PorchLight Real Estate does a lot of charity work in the community and ECM is on of the organizations they volunteer for. "The Work Day brought us more together as a team. Some of us don't see each other in the office that much, even some co-workers have never talked to each other. So, this was a great opportunity to connect and get to know each other better," Caroline explains. They enjoyed talking with each other, meeting the homeowners and working alongside others in their industry. " The Real Estate Industry Work Day is very helpful because these are some of our busiest months. We don't have to follow-up with anyone or organize anything. We just show up," Caroline explains.Extreme Community Makeover is working towards building up communities and building up industries in Denver. We know the value of connecting with businesses in the community. When Denver businesses thrive, the communities around them thrive.
